Clear All Filters
Sage Green Regular Fit Long Sleeve Oxford Shirt
£26
Slate Grey Linear Texture Popper Shacket
£42
Pink Slim Fit Long Sleeve Oxford Shirt
GANT Black Cord Collar Worker Overshirt
£175
Charcoal Grey Slim Fit Long Sleeve Oxford Shirt
Chocolate Brown Long Sleeve Garment Dyed Oxford Shirt
£35
Green Signature Moons British Wool Textured Blazer
£179
Dark Green Regular Fit Long Sleeve Oxford Shirt
Green Lurex Stripe Regular Fit Smart Trimmed Long Sleeve Party Shirt
£38
Dark Green Slim Fit Long Sleeve Oxford Shirt